Abstract:
Hansenia trifoliolata Q.P.Jiang & X.J.He (Apiaceae), is described as new from Shaanxi Province, northwest China. The mericarp features of H. trifoliolata resemble H. himalayensis and H. phaea and molecular phylogenetic analyses (combining ITS and plastid genomes data) suggest that H. trifoliolata is closely related to the group formed by H. oviformis and H. forbesii . The new species H. trifoliolata has unique 3-foliolate leaves and differ from other Hansenia species in its leaves, umbel numbers and size. A comprehensive description of H. trifoliolata is provided, including habitat environment and detailed morphological traits.
